A Developmental Journey that Grows with Your Child
Authentic, loving songs follow a child's natural developmental progression, helping families sing their way through the everyday moments of childhood.
Connection → Body → World → Imagination → Feelings → Independence
Each book includes six original songs and a special You Say It, I Say It page that invites children to revisit favorite words and pictures through playful listening and speaking.
Through music and joy, your child will learn their first 300 Mandarin words for loving moments.
Many of the songs were inspired by family games, traditions, and cherished rituals shared across generations in Chinese families, introducing Mandarin as a living language rooted in connection, culture, and belonging.
Book 1 — Hello, Hello
Songs for closeness and comfort, for holding, bonding, and simply being together. Through cuddles, routines, and shared moments, children begin to associate language with warmth, security, and love.
- Hello — 你好 (nǐ hǎo)
- Smile — 笑一个 (xiào yí gè)
- Rock You — 摇摇你 (yáo yao nǐ)
- Baby Is Crying — 宝宝哭了 (bǎo bao kū le)
- Go Out to Play — 出去玩 (chū qù wán)
- Sleep — 睡觉 (shuì jiào)
- You Say It, I Say It — 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ō, wǒ shuō)
Book 2 — Let's Move
Songs for the body in motion. Through stretching, lifting, splashing, and playing together, children begin to connect Mandarin words with movement and meaning. Language becomes something they can do.
- Good Morning 早上好 (zǎo shang hǎo)
- Let's Exercise 做运动 (zuò yùn dòng)
- Fingers 手指头 (shǒu zhǐ tou)
- Lift Up High 举高高 (jǔ gāo gāo)
- Spin in a Circle 转圈圈 (zhuǎn quān quān)
- Take a Bath 洗澡澡 (xǐ zǎo zǎo)
- You Say It, I Say It 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ō wǒ shuō)
Book 3 — Let's Explore
Songs for discovering the world around us. Through naming the body, foods, animals, home, nature and everyday discoveries, children begin to connect Mandarin words with the people, places, and experiences that fill their growing world. Language becomes a tool for curiosity and exploration.
- Little Friend 小朋友 (xiǎo péng yǒu)
- Carrot 胡萝卜 (hú luó bo)
- Tap the Foot 点脚丫 (diǎn jiǎo yā)
- What Do You Say 说什么 (shuō shén me)
- The Shadows Are Out 影子出来了 (yǐng zi chū lái le)
- Good Night 晚安 (wǎn ān)
- You Say It, I Say It 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ō wǒ shuō)
Book 4 — Let's Imagine
Songs celebrate creativity and imagination. Through pretend play, silly surprises, make-believe, and unfolding stories, children begin to use language not only to describe the world, but also to create new worlds of their own. Language becomes a tool for creativity and self-expression.
- Is It Yummy 好吃吗 (hǎo chī ma)
- Little Child 小孩子 (xiǎo hái zi)
- Airplane Ride 坐飞机 (zuò fēi jī)
- Hat Is Gone 帽子不见了 (mào zi bù jiàn le)
- Clap Clap Clap 拍拍拍 (pāi pāi pāi)
- Goodbye 再见 (zài jiàn)
- You Say It, I Say It 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ō wǒ shuō)
Book 5 — Big Feelings
Songs for feelings and growth. Through songs about feelings, relationships, making choices, and taking brave little steps, children begin to recognize, express, and talk about what is happening inside themselves. Language becomes a tool for empathy, self-understanding, and connection with others.
- Slap the Mosquito 打蚊子 (dǎ wén zi)
- Touch the Nose 摸鼻子 (mō bí zi)
- Happy, Sad, Mad 开心伤心生气 (kāi xīn shāng xīn shēng qì)
- Climb the Stairs 爬楼梯 (pá lóu tī)
- Clean Up 收起来 (shōu qǐ lái)
- It Is Raining 下雨了 (xià yǔ le)
- You Say It, I Say It 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ō wǒ shuō)
Book 6 — I Can Do It
Songs for growing confidence and independence. Through playing games together, helping, caring, and doing things for oneself, children joyfully discover their own abilities and place in the world. Language becomes a tool for confidence, responsibility, and self-expression.
- Buckle Up 扣起来 (kòu qǐ lái)
- Caught a Cold 感冒了 (gǎn mào le)
- Washing Hands 洗洗手 (xǐ xǐ shǒu)
- Brushing Teeth 刷刷牙 (shuā shuā yá)
- Penguins Are Dancing 企鹅在跳舞 (qǐ é zài tiào wǔ)
- Wooden People 木头人 (mù tou rén)
- You Say It, I Say It 你说,我说 (nǐ shuō wǒ shuō)
